Item 1C. Cybersecurity.

Item 1C. Cybersecurity. Cybersecurity Risk Management and Strategy 73 Table of Contents We have developed and implemented a cybersecurity program intended to protect the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of our critical systems and information. Our cybersecurity program includes a cybersecurity incident response plan. We design and assess our program based on the National Institute of Standards and Technology Cybersecurity Framework (NIST CSF). This does not imply that we meet any particular technical standards, specifications, or requirements, only that we use the NIST CSF as a guide to help us identify, assess, and manage cybersecurity risks relevant to our business. Our cybersecurity program is integrated into our overall risk management program and includes reporting channels to the executive management team and an internal Cybersecurity Oversight Committee, as well as governance processes which communicate cybersecurity risks to departments across the organization, including legal, strategic, operational, and financial areas. This encourages consideration of cybersecurity oversight, accountability and diligence across the organization. Our cybersecurity program includes: Processes to assess cybersecurity risk, designed to help identify material cybersecurity risks to critical systems, information, products, services, and the broader enterprise information technology environment; a security team principally responsible for coordinating and managing (1) cybersecurity risk evaluation processes, (2) implementation of cybersecurity controls, and (3) response to cybersecurity incidents; the use of external service providers, where appropriate, to assess, test or otherwise assist with aspects of the organization s cybersecurity controls; cybersecurity awareness training of employees, incident response personnel, including third party providers, and senior management; a cybersecurity incident response plan which includes procedures for responding to cybersecurity incidents; and a third-party risk management process for service providers, suppliers, and vendors that have access to sensitive data or information. We have not identified risks from known cybersecurity threats, including as a result of any prior cybersecurity incidents, which have materially affected or are reasonably likely to materially affect the organization, including operations, business strategy, results of operations, or financial condition. Cybersecurity Governance Our Board considers cybersecurity risk as part of its risk oversight function and has delegated oversight of cybersecurity and other information technology risks to the Audit Committee. The Audit Committee oversees management s implementation of the cybersecurity program. The Audit Committee receives formal annual reports from management regarding cybersecurity risks. In addition, management updates the Board and Audit Committee, as necessary, regarding any material cybersecurity incidents, as well as any incidents with lesser impact potential. The Audit Committee reports to the full Board regarding its activities, including those related to cybersecurity. Our management team including the Executive Vice President, Technical Operations and Administration is responsible for assessing and managing material risks from cybersecurity threats. The team has primary responsibility for our overall cybersecurity program and supervises both our internal cybersecurity personnel and our retained external cybersecurity consultants. Our management team s experience includes collective decades of experience working in and overseeing information technology and cybersecurity functions, technical cybersecurity certifications, and active membership in cybersecurity professional organizations, as well as local groups, to support knowledge sharing and ongoing education. 74 Table of Contents Our management team supervises efforts to prevent, detect, mitigate, and remediate cybersecurity risks and incidents through various means, which may include briefings from internal security personnel; threat intelligence and other information obtained from governmental, public or private sources, including external consultants engaged by us and alerts and reports produced by security tools deployed in the information technology environment.
